Former Wizards coach Eddie Jordan is back coaching — high school freshmen
Former Wizards coach Eddie Jordan has returned to coaching – though not how you would expect. Less than two years after he was fired by the Philadelphia 76ers, Jordan is coaching the freshman basketball team at his alma mater, Archbishop Carroll.
Jordan was the most successful Wizards coach in recent memory, leading the franchise to 197 wins and four playoff appearances before...
